Abstract: |
Systematic archaeological fieldwalking was undertaken on a site which had produced much evidence of medieval activity. Watching briefs during gravel extraction on the northern part of the site had shown the potential of the area for the study of medieval and earlier remains. Pottery from the late medieval and post-medieval periods were recovered and plotted during the exercise. [AIP] |
